Conor McGregor UFC news: Notorious reiterates desire to fight at new Allegiant Stadium in Las Vegas

Conor McGregor has reiterated his desire to be the first person to fight at the new Allegiant Stadium in Las Vegas.

Construction on the stadium, which will be home to the NFL's Las Vegas Raiders and the University of Nevada, Las Vegas Rebels college football team, is almost completed.

The Notorious previously stated that he would be interested in taking on Manny Pacquiao at the venue.

Speaking prior to his fight with Donald Cerrone in January, McGregor said: "It will be hard to leave the MMA game fully but I think a boxing world title is a great aspiration to have.

"What a feather in the cap it would be. I always want bigger and better and to reach for the stars.

"I would love the rematch with Floyd Mayweather and I know the Manny one is there whenever I want it."

He added: "I would be honoured and love to be the first combatant to fight in that arena and what a fight that would be against a small and powerful southpaw.

"We would have to figure out the weight we do it at but it interests me, no doubt."

McGregor recently retweeted a tweet calling for him to be the first man to fight at the stadium.

UFC star Jorge Masvidal also expressed a desire to fight McGregor at the venue earlier in the year, saying a bout there between them "would be huge".
